State House Candidate Gabriel Fancher Announces Endorsements From Rutherford County Leaders

Rutherford County Schools teacher and candidate for State House, Gabriel Fancher, announced the endorsements of several key business and community leaders throughout Rutherford County. Including Rockvale businessman Jim Thompson, County Commissioners Virgil Gammon and David Gammon and Eagleville Mayor and Vice Mayor, Chad Leeman and Bill Tollett.

Virgil Gammon and David Gammon are longtime veterans of law enforcement and have each served on the Rutherford County Commission for four years.

“Rutherford County needs to send Gabriel Fancher to represent us in Nashville. I’m confident he will be a strong voice for law enforcement. I know he will be able to work with people to achieve the results we need here in Rutherford County," stated Commissioner Virgil Gammon.

Commissioner David Gammon echoed his comments and also said, “Gabriel will be a fantastic voice for the people of LaVergne and Rutherford County. I know him as a conservative family man who will work well with other state leaders to produce results for Rutherford County.”

Longtime Rockvale resident and businessman Jim Thompson endorsed Fancher and encouraged District 13 to support him by saying , “Gabriel has the knowledge, energy, desire, and commitment to represent the 13th district. He is a natural giver of his talents!”

Eagleville Mayor Chad Leeman joined others in supporting Fancher and said, “Gabriel is an educator, father, and conservative who deserves our support. He shares our fundamental conservative values and will fight hard for the people of Eagleville and Rutherford County.”

Eagleville Vice Mayor Bill Tollett, former principal of Eagleville School and owner of Coach T’s All American Grill in Eagleville stated, “I’m a retired educator of more than 30 years and a small business owner. I’m supporting Gabriel because we finally need to send someone who has experience in the classroom to the State House. He will support our small businesses and work hard to represent the diverse needs of District 13. Please join me in supporting Gabriel Fancher in the Republican Primary on August 4th.”

Fancher stated, “I’ve been fortunate to have the support and trust from leaders across District 13. I’m asking for your vote to help me win this election and serve you and your family.”

Fancher was an English teacher at Holloway High School in Murfreesboro before signing on to be an Economics teacher at Rockvale High School this coming fall.. He has been a teacher since 2008 where he first served as an adjunct faculty member at several local colleges before becoming a public school teacher in 2020. Fancher is a former Rutherford County Chamber of Commerce diplomat and a 2020 graduate of Leadership Rutherford. He previously served as chairman of the Rutherford County Young Republicans and secretary of the Rutherford County Republican Party. He currently coaches his daughter’s soccer team for the Murfreesboro Soccer Club and has coached boys and girls basketball with One Goal Sports. Gabriel and his wife Chelsea have seven children in their blended family.
